March 22, 20215 yr Airport EGNX Runway 28 not an addon airport not in the middle of no where. But a good average airport to test. Live weather was 6/8 cloud cover. Setting Ultra, 1440p MSFS 172 (None Glass) FPS 58 JF PA-28 FPS 54 CJ4wt FPS 50 MSFS A320 Neo FPS 49 Carenado M20 FPS 48 AS CRJ FPS 36 Or as a percentage from the 172 JF PA-28 - 5% CJ4wt - 13% MSFS A320 Neo - 14% Carenado M20 - 15% AS CRJ - 38% David Murden.
